Summary
Declares the Senate expresses: (1) the gratitude of the Nation to U.S. armed forces participating in Operation Enduring Freedom, including their families who have bourne the burden of separation from their loved ones, and staunchly supported them during this effort; and (2) its condolences to the families of brave American service personnel who lost their lives defending America in the war against terrorism. Reaffirms that it stands united with the President in the ongoing efforts to defeat terrorism.
